Skip to content

Commit 64e3c26

Browse files
committed
Code refactor for select image from gallery
1 parent bade708 commit 64e3c26

File tree

1 file changed

+6
-4
lines changed

1 file changed

+6
-4
lines changed

Controller/Adminhtml/Post/Save.php

+6-4
Original file line numberDiff line numberDiff line change
@@ -71,10 +71,12 @@ protected function _beforeSave($model, $request)
7171

7272
$model->setData($key, $image);
7373
} else {
74-
if (isset($data[$key][0]['url']) && false != strpos($data[$key][0]['url'], '/media/')){
75-
$index = strpos($data[$key][0]['url'], '/media/');
76-
$result = substr($data[$key][0]['url'], $index + strlen('/media/'));
77-
$model->setData($key, $result);
74+
if (isset($data[$key][0]['url'])
75+
&& false != ($position = strpos($data[$key][0]['url'], '/media/'))) {
76+
$model->setData(
77+
$key,
78+
substr($data[$key][0]['url'], $position + strlen('/media/'))
79+
);
7880
} elseif (isset($data[$key][0]['name'])) {
7981
$model->setData($key, $data[$key][0]['name']);
8082
}

0 commit comments

Comments
 (0)